Here at St. Paul the teaching of our children is held in high esteem. We believe that children are loved by God, need to be taught the basics of the Christian faith, and best learn these lessons when they are modeled in the lives of their parents.

Sunday School is open for all ages 3 and above. In addition to regular lessons, the children sing and have activities that reinforce the lesson of the day. The children also sing in church from time to time. The general rule for the Sunday School schedule is that classes begin the Sunday after Labor Day and finish the Sunday before Memorial Day, so we go from September to May.

Confirmation helps students ages 6 – 8 grade to learn about the Bible, to learn about our Lutheran understanding of the Bible, and to explore what they believe. We use the Bible and Martin Luther’s Small Catechism, and group discussions to help achieve that goal. Students are confirmed on the first Sunday in May. High School Bible Study Group focuses on the application of Scriptural principles to issues relating to their age-specific life situations.

Youth Group Activities include fellowship centered around fundraising events, including an annual Easter Breakfast and Spring Rummage Sale. Monies raised are used toward attending the triennial Lutheran Youth Encounter.
